Transaction 70a03b7b59d9e020d8e1177dd7d19f970fa40903fa13bf76a0b558cbe43db973
1 Input
1 Output
-
70a03b7b59d9e020d8e1177dd7d19f970fa40903fa13bf76a0b558cbe43db973:0
- value
- 689753
- script pubkey
- OP_0 OP_PUSHBYTES_20 45f26b17c2d37a65834e65d8bb68c7e065b79cb1
- address
- bc1qghexk97z6daxtq6wvhvtk6x8upjm0893f6zg42